Victory Capital Management Inc. raised its stake in Veritex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:VBTX - Free Report) by 3.0% in the 1st qu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 2,040,856 shares of the financial services provider's stock after acquiring an additional 59,056 shares during the quarter. Victory Capital Management Inc. owned about 3.75% of Veritex worth $50,960,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Veritex (NASDAQ:VBTX -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Friday, July 18th. The financial services provider reported $0.56 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.54 by $0.02. Veritex had a return on equity of 7.59% and a net margin of 14.83%. The business had revenue of $109.83 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$110.91 million.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$0.52 earnings per share. As a group, sell-side analysts predict that Veritex Holdings, Inc. will post 2.26 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Veritex Holdings, Inc operates as the bank holding company for Veritex Community Bank that provides various commercial banking products and services to small and medium-sized businesses, and professionals. The company accepts deposit products include demand, savings, money market, and time accounts. Its loan products include commercial real estate and general commercial, mortgage warehouse loans, residential real estate, construction and land, farmland, paycheck protection program, 1-4 family residential, agricultural, multi-family residential, and consumer loans, as well as purchased receivables financing.
